3h ago

Staff Engineer

Barcelona

✨ $120k-$160k / yearest.

full-timesenior HybridFintech

πŸ›  Tech Stack

πŸ’Ό About This Role

You'll design and evolve systems for payment routing, fraud prevention, and anomaly detection in a global payments platform serving 40+ emerging markets. You'll drive technical architecture and scalability of Java-based services. This role offers the opportunity to impact millions of daily transactions and work with a diverse international team.

🎯 What You'll Do

  • Design and build scalable Java applications for payment routing.
  • Develop real-time fraud decisioning tools using data and ML models.
  • Optimize application performance and troubleshoot system bottlenecks.
  • Conduct code reviews and enforce high software standards.

πŸ“‹ Requirements

  • 7+ years of professional experience in Java development.
  • Bachelor’s degree in software engineering or computer science.
  • In-depth knowledge of object-oriented design and design patterns.
  • Experience with cloud platforms such as AWS or GCP.

✨ Nice to Have

  • Event-driven architecture design experience.
  • Experience with monitoring tools like Datadog, Grafana, or ELK.

🎁 Benefits & Perks

  • 🌍 International career with 30+ nationalities.
  • πŸ–οΈ Flexible hybrid work in Barcelona.
  • πŸ“š Learning and development opportunities.

🚩 Heads Up

  • Requires 7+ years experience but title is Staff Engineer, which may indicate over-leveling.
  • Lists project management skills and high-level project management as a requirement, which is uncommon for a pure engineering role.
0 0 0